Understanding Adult Psychiatry
Adult psychiatry involves evaluating, identifying, and dealing with mental health disorders in grownups. Psychiatrists are licensed physicians trained to understand the complicated interactions in between mental and physical health. They can recommend medications, conduct treatment, and recommend other treatments.
Some typical mental health conditions dealt with by adult psychiatrists include:

DepressionAnxiety DisordersBipolar affective disorderSchizophreniaCompound Use DisordersPTSD (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der)
The Importance of Finding the Right Psychiatrist
Mental health treatment is extremely embellished; therefore, discovering a psychiatrist who lines up with your requirements is important. Aspects to think about include:
Specialization: Not all psychiatrists manage every kind of disorder, so it's vital to find one that specializes in your condition. Treatment Approach: Some psychiatrists might concentrate on therapy while others may focus on medication management. Area and Accessibility: Opt for a psychiatrist whose practice is easily situated and fits into your schedule. Insurance Coverage: Validate whether your insurance coverage plan covers the psychiatrist's services to prevent any unforeseen costs.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is the difference in between a psychiatrist and a psychologist?
While both professionals supply mental health services, a psychiatrist is a medical doctor who can recommend medication, while a psychologist generally concentrates on treatment and can not recommend medication (though this can vary by state).
Do I need a recommendation to see a psychiatrist?

The length of time will I need to see a psychiatrist?
The duration of treatment differs per person and can depend on the intensity of the condition. Some people may just require a few sessions, while others may need continuous care.
Are telepsychiatry alternatives readily available?
Yes, numerous psychiatrists now offer virtual consultations, making it much easier to access care from the convenience of your home.
What should I give my first visit?
It's advisable to bring medical records, a list of your medications, family history of mental health concerns, and any concerns you might have about treatment choices.
